1,598,238,084,983,085 is an odd composite number composed of nine pr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 1598238084983085 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 9 prime factors (large circles) and 1920 divisors.

1598238084983085 is an odd composite number. It is composed of nine dist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, nine h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 1598238084983085:

32 × 5 × 74 × 13 × 17 × 29 × 61 × 157 × 241

(3 × 3 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 17 × 29 × 61 × 157 × 241)
